The arms were officially granted on June 6, 1698, again on March 24, 1703 and confirmed on October 16, 1817.
 
The arms may be decorated with the French War Cross 1914-1918.
 
The gun refers to the important military past of the town and its fortress. The three towers are the Victoire, Grégoire and Maugis towers in the town.
